Which of the following compounds can have a triple bond?
A). C₂H₄
B). C₃H₄
C). C₃H₆

Final answer:

Only C₃H₄ can have a triple bond.

Step-by-step explanation:

Out of the given compounds, only C₃H₄ can have a triple bond. A triple bond consists of one sigma bond and two pi bonds between two atoms. In the case of C₃H₄, the carbon atoms can form a triple bond with each other, resulting in a molecule with a linear shape and three sigma bonds.
